Fulham, Crystal Palace And West Ham Among Clubs Battling For Kennedy Igboananike
Published: August 08, 2013
Last season, AIK's Kennedy Igboananike had limited playing time at rivals Djurgården following his much publicized row.
But this year Kennedy Igboananike has notched up 9 Premier League goals in 18 matches.
The interest from European clubs are growing constantly. Foreign scouts have been in place in Sweden to study the striker, including in the last league match against Elfsborg.
Fotbolltransfers.com can reveal that clubs like Fulham, West Ham, Crystal Palace, Brighton & Hove Albion, Genclerbirligi and Antalyaspor have scouted Igboananike in recent times.
'' I know the interest that clubs follow him, '' confirms 24-year-old's agent Innocent Okeke to Fotbolltransfers.com.
